When to book a photographer

How soon is too soon to book a photographer? Would it be crazy to do so in the next month or two for our august 2013 wedding?

Re: When to book a photographer

  • Not crazy at all. Really good photographers can book as far as three years in advance. Plus rates tend to increase annually, so you will most likely be saving yourself some money. If you find a photographer that you absolutely want, then I say book them as soon as you can so you do not miss out. 
  • Not necessarily.  I started looking 9 months out and many of my first choices were already booked for my date.  I don't think a year out is crazy at all, especially in a major city where the popular wedding photographers book fast.
  • I am trying to book 15 months in advance and am finding that 1/2 of the weekends next APRIL are already taken by the photographer I want.
